Specific cultural features of Kawęczyn include a manor estate built in the 19th century: the single-storey manor house with a cross wing and a terrace supported by arcades was expanded in the 1930s. Culture and History
The park and the remaining historic building can only be viewed from behind a fence.

Landscape and Nature
The Turek Hills are located in the area surrounding Kawęczyn.
The manor complex includes an old park that historically combined motifs of the French formal garden and the English landscape garden.
The Kawęczyn commune encompasses the Teleszyna Valley, which is described as part of the Uniejów Landscape Protection Area. It is also reported that rare bird and plant species occur in the commune, including the black stork.
Location and Transport Connections
The Kawęczyn commune lies in the south-eastern part of the Greater Poland Voivodeship and in Turek County. The commune is connected by National Road 83 between Turek and Sieradz and Voivodeship Road 471 between Kalisz and Łódź.
